Transaction 80e2114df012909252cfaf9d966beccf476665e095403dba3adf589a105990d3
1 Input
1 Output
-
80e2114df012909252cfaf9d966beccf476665e095403dba3adf589a105990d3:0
- value
- 459696557
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 34cb55e1a91c48590da26ce6e39b626071ad8d38 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15p9iyMaYgtc7tiB2UQoyNiUtiBhpo3DRV